Output 8094d545b930c20bf71a6ec8ed03d50fc6d2d94bb97fa6607049e87d6027a593:3

value
49448883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 844e81d224f045bebce2bc72715d4c33c2366752 OP_EQUAL
address
MKxjUXD1koijfZSot21tUD3gRjyPDuZP1f
transaction
8094d545b930c20bf71a6ec8ed03d50fc6d2d94bb97fa6607049e87d6027a593
spent
true